Ordinals
beta
Sat 719937290139068
decimal
143987.2290139068
degree
0°143987′851″2290139068‴
percentile
34.2827281395714%
name
itdppabwzmb
cycle
0
epoch
0
period
71
block
143987
offset
2290139068
timestamp
2011-09-05 02:37:06 UTC
rarity
common
prev
next